    Say No to These! 10 Skincare Ingredients That Don't Belong On Your Face

    Did you know that some common skincare ingredients can actually be harmful to their skin? Here are 10 items to steer clear of:

    • Parabens: These preservatives can harm hormone functions
    • Sulfates: This can strip your skin of its natural oils, causing dryness and irritation
    • Formaldehyde: A known carcinogen that can be found in some lotions
    • Phthalates: These chemicals can affect hormone levels
    • Triclosan: An antibacterial agent that has been linked to immune system problems
    • Oxybenzone: A sunscreen ingredient that can damage coral reefs and may even be harmful to human health
    • Alcohol: While some alcohols can be beneficial, large amounts can dehydrate your skin
    • Sodium Lauryl Sulfate (SLS): A strong surfactant that can damage sensitive skin
    • Coal Tar: A known carcinogen that can be found in some medicated products
    • Fragrance: Artificial fragrances can contain various ingredients that may harm your skin

    It's important to read the ingredient list of your skincare products carefully and choose formulations with natural and gentle ingredients.
